Crystal Growth and Spectroscopic Characterization of Aloevera Amino Acid Added Lithium Sulfate Monohydrate: A Non-Linear Optical Crystal

R Manimekalai, A Antony Joseph, C Ramachandra Raja

Spectrochim Acta A Mol Biomol Spectrosc. 2014 Mar 25;122:232-7.

PMID: 24316535

Abstract:

Non-linear optical crystals of lithium sulfate monohydrate added with Aloevera amino acid were grown successfully by slow evaporation technique moderately at low cost. Initially the Aloevera amino acid extract was prepared from the 3 years old plant leaves and the amino acids present in that were identified by high performance liquid chromatography. The grown crystal was clear, transparent and they attained the size about 1.3×0.8×0.6 cm(3) within a time span of 20-25 days. The crystal was subjected to Fourier Transform Infrared Spectroscopy, UV-Vis-NIR, thermal and mechanical studies. Proton nuclear magnetic resonance, thin layer chromatography and colorimetric estimation techniques are carried out to confirm and identify the amino acid in the grown crystal.
